Head of Revenue Operations

This position is listed on behalf of a partner company, who manages all applications and next steps. Our partner is looking for a Head of Revenue Operations based in the United States.

This senior leadership role sits at the core of the Go-To-Market organization, shaping the operational engine that drives revenue growth, forecasting accuracy, and scalable execution. The Head of Revenue Operations will partner closely with executive leadership to design and optimize the systems, processes, and analytics that support Sales, Marketing, Customer Success, and Finance. This role plays a critical part in translating complex business data into clear, actionable insights that enable faster and better decision-making across the organization. Operating in a high-growth, fast-paced environment, the role requires both strategic vision and hands-on execution. The ideal candidate will thrive in ambiguity, bringing structure, clarity, and rigor to evolving business challenges. This is a high-impact opportunity to build and scale the infrastructure that supports long-term revenue performance and operational excellence.

Accountabilities:
  • Lead the end-to-end Revenue Operations function across GTM, Marketing, Post-Sales, and strategic initiatives, ensuring alignment with company growth objectives and execution priorities.
  • Own forecasting, pipeline management, and revenue planning processes, improving accuracy, consistency, and executive visibility into business performance.
  • Design and continuously enhance reporting and analytics frameworks to provide leadership with clear, actionable insights for decision-making.
  • Manage executive operating cadences including QBRs, forecast reviews, and strategic planning cycles, ensuring consistency in metrics and narratives.
  • Drive annual and in-year GTM planning, including territory design, capacity planning, quota setting, compensation design, and resource allocation.
  • Partner closely with GTM Systems and cross-functional teams to optimize CRM, data infrastructure, and operational tooling.
  • Translate complex data into compelling business stories that influence executive and board-level decisions.
  • Lead initiatives to automate reporting, improve data quality, and scale analytics capabilities across the organization.
  • Provide leadership, mentorship, and development to the Revenue Operations and analytics team.
Requirements:
  • 10+ years of experience in Revenue Operations, Sales Operations, Business Analytics, Consulting, or related fields, with strong exposure to SaaS environments.
  • Deep expertise in forecasting, pipeline management, revenue planning, territory design, quota setting, and compensation frameworks.
  • Proven ability to influence executive stakeholders through data-driven insights, strong communication, and structured thinking.
  • Strong analytical background with hands-on experience working with CRM systems, BI tools, and large-scale datasets.
  • Ability to operate effectively in ambiguous, fast-moving environments with a strong bias toward execution and outcomes.
  • Excellent storytelling skills, with the ability to translate complex analysis into clear business recommendations.
  • Experience collaborating across Sales, Marketing, Customer Success, and Finance in a high-growth organization.
  • Strong systems thinking mindset with the ability to understand long-term operational impacts.
  • Demonstrated leadership experience in building, mentoring, and scaling high-performing teams.
